547878
000000000000000000201ffef8b9f7615edff75546b2616871609ece2bc2d66d
Time
10-30-2018 05:10:52 (Local)
Sponsored
Transaction Fees
0.00254338
BTC
Confirmations
375458
Total Amounts
1295451.21973829 USDT
Transaction Counts
44
Previous Block:
Merkle Root:
5d497d42321d18403dab46310306acad267cacb4758aa019a1227edd8b59693b
APIs